arm64: zynqmp: Fix address for tca6416_u97 chip on zcu104
authorMichal Simek <michal.simek@xilinx.com>
Tue, 29 May 2018 13:28:43 +0000 (15:28 +0200)
committerMichal Simek <michal.simek@xilinx.com>
Thu, 31 May 2018 11:50:39 +0000 (13:50 +0200)
I2c address is not 0x21 but 0x20. This patch is fixing both revA and
revC boards.

Signed-off-by: Michal Simek <michal.simek@xilinx.com>
arch/arm/dts/zynqmp-zcu104-revA.dts
arch/arm/dts/zynqmp-zcu104-revC.dts

index a0e13d8..6a4b701 100644 (file)
                        #address-cells = <1>;
                        #size-cells = <0>;
                        reg = <4>;
-                       tca6416_u97: gpio@21 {
+                       tca6416_u97: gpio@20 {
                                compatible = "ti,tca6416";
-                               reg = <0x21>;
+                               reg = <0x20>;
                                gpio-controller;
                                #gpio-cells = <2>;
                                /*
index f3ab99a..fe742b8 100644 (file)
@@ -74,9 +74,9 @@
        status = "okay";
        clock-frequency = <400000>;
 
-       tca6416_u97: gpio@21 {
+       tca6416_u97: gpio@20 {
                compatible = "ti,tca6416";
-               reg = <0x21>;
+               reg = <0x20>;
                gpio-controller;
                #gpio-cells = <2>;
                /*